What Are Poppers, Really?
Poppers is the slang term for a group of chemicals known as alkyl nitrites — most commonly amyl nitrite . They’re inhaled for a brief, euphoric, warm and fuzzy head rush, and they also work their magic on smooth muscle relaxation. Translation? Easier, more pleasurable anal sex.
That’s why the term "poppers and anal relaxation" has become practically synonymous — and not just in Google search.
But poppers weren’t always a go-to sex aid. Long before they became a bedroom staple (or club-floor co-star), they were saving lives.
From Angina to “Ahhhh”: Poppers as Medicine
Back in 1867, amyl nitrite was used as a treatment for angina pectoris, a type of chest pain caused by reduced blood flow to the heart. A Scottish physician named Sir Thomas Lauder Brunton discovered that inhaling amyl nitrite could quickly relax blood vessels and relieve chest tightness.
Yep — the original purpose of poppers was literally to open your heart, not your...well, other muscles.
These early versions were stored in tiny glass ampoules called “ pearls.” Patients crushed them between their fingers, releasing a loud pop — giving rise to the slang name “poppers.” (Bonus trivia win: “poppers origin term pearls” right there.)
The Rise of Poppers: A Queer Revolution
Poppers didn’t crash the gay party until the 1960s, and by the 1970s, they had taken up permanent residence in queer nightlife. According to the broader history of poppers , their popularity skyrocketed in the LGBTQ+ community — particularly among gay men — because of their ability to relax involuntary muscles like the anus while enhancing the intensity of orgasm.
This combo made them a bedroom MVP and a dance floor sidekick, particularly in spaces like Fire Island, San Francisco bathhouses, and New York’s West Village.
Poppers became more than a sex aid. They were part of queer expression, rebellion, and community — and remain deeply embedded in poppers community history.
Poppers Today: Not Just for the Gays Anymore
While their roots run deep in the gay community, today’s poppers have gone mainstream. Everyone from curious straight couples to TikTok explorers are asking what are poppers used for, and the answer is evolving.
The chemical kick can intensify orgasms for people of all orientations and identities. The short-lived “high” — technically caused by sudden vasodilation and blood pressure drop — offers a fleeting sense of euphoria, warmth, and full-body release.

Wait...Are Poppers Legal?
The poppers legal status in the USA is a little...murky. In the 1980s, they were banned under the Anti-Drug Abuse Act, but clever marketers found a workaround. Today, poppers are sold as “video head cleaner,” “leather cleaner,” or “room deodorizer” — wink wink.
That’s why, if you're Googling what are poppers used for, you'll often land on cleaner listings instead of chemist-backed FAQs.
Looking globally? The poppers legality in Australia is more transparent. After a brief panic and proposed ban, poppers were reclassified and are now available by prescription through pharmacies — sitting right next to your multivitamins and...actual nail polish remover.
What’s Inside: Alkyl Nitrites Definition
So what exactly are alkyl nitrites? Chemically speaking, they’re esters of nitrous acid and alcohols. But for the rest of us non-chemists, they’re volatile compounds that evaporate quickly at room temp and hit your bloodstream almost instantly via the lungs.
The most common types are:
Amyl nitrite
Butyl nitrite
Isobutyl nitrite
Isopropyl nitrite
These slight variations in formula can affect the potency, burn, and duration of your experience. Hence why seasoned users have their best poppers brand loyalties.
Inhale With Caution: Side Effects & Safety Tips
Just because it’s fun doesn’t mean it’s risk-free. Let’s talk poppers side effects — and how to stay safe.
Short-term effects can include:
Dizziness
Headache
Flushed skin
Drop in blood pressure
Nausea if overused or mixed with alcohol
Long-term or unsafe use may lead to:
Skin irritation around the nose
Risk of methemoglobinemia (blood oxygen issues)
Increased risk of injury if combined with other vasodilators (like ED meds)
And yes, there’s a difference between poppers side effects in general and poppers side effects from inhalants specifically.
Poppers usage safety tips:
Don’t combine with Viagra or other nitrates
Don’t drink the liquid (it’s toxic)
Use in ventilated spaces
Take breaks between hits
Listen to your body
